Biography

American singer / songwriter, based in Los Angeles, California and life partner of [a3102777]. Born: October 9, 1948, U.S. Army base, Heidelberg, Germany Inducted into Rock And Roll Hall of Fame in 2004 (Performer). Inducted into Songwriters Hall of Fame in 2007.
